» Getting Paid, Volume 1, Issue 7, 2001

7. What is the most significant problem you face getting paid? Is it:?

Response
1 Slow or late payment 45
2 Cost of using credit cards 3
3 Bounced or bad checks 16
4 Failure to get bills paid in full 6
5 Bankruptcies 4
6 Other 16
7 DK/Refuse 11
Total (%) 101
N 757

Notes: Forty-five (45) percent of small employers identify slow or late payment as the most significant problem they encounter getting payment for the goods provided or services rendered (Q#7).
